What We Do
We translate your business requirements into a concrete solution blueprint — covering system configuration, integration points, data flows, user roles, and process changes. We work at the intersection of business and technology, ensuring both sides understand and agree on what will be built before building begins.
Deliverables
- Business process maps — current and future-state process documentation
- Solution blueprint — high-level architecture describing how the system will be configured and how it connects to other tools
- Integration design — specification of data flows, triggers, and integration patterns between systems
- Data migration plan — approach for migrating existing data into the new system
- User role and access matrix — who can see and do what in the new system
- Configuration specification — detailed requirements for how the system should be set up
- Acceptance criteria — clear, testable definitions of what done looks like for each component
Our Process
- Discover — deep-dive into your current processes, data structures, and integration landscape
- Design — model future-state processes and solution architecture
- Review — validate design with business stakeholders and technical teams
- Document — produce the full solution blueprint and specification package
- Handover — briefing for the implementation team with Q&A to ensure shared understanding
Frequently Asked Questions
Do we need solution design if the vendor does implementation too?
In many cases, yes. Vendors are expert in their own product, but independent solution design ensures configuration reflects your business requirements rather than the vendor’s standard approach. It also gives you a document you own — independent of the vendor relationship.
Can you work with our internal IT team on the design?
Yes. We often work alongside internal technical architects and IT managers, contributing the business analysis and process design layer while your team handles the technical architecture.
What if our requirements are not fully defined yet?
We can help with that as part of the engagement. Requirement refinement and process mapping are typically the first activities in a solution design engagement.
